Australians have spent more than one billion hours on their PS4s in the past 12-months

PlayStation Australia announced today that Australians have spent more than one billion hours on their PS4s in the past 12-months. This figure is a 26% increase in usage over the previous 12-months.

The one billion hours (which equals 100,000 years) was spent on games, TV, music and video. In Australia, 67% of people play video games and 3.7 million subscribe to a streaming service. Consumption of music, TV and video on PS4 increased 45% in the past 12-months. PlayStation owners have access to Spotify, Stan, Netflix, PlayStation Store videos, Foxtel Now and more.

This is the first time the one billion hour milestone has been crossed in Australia. Patrick Lagana, Director of Marketing, Sony Interactive Entertainment Australia said, “PlayStation has been the country’s highest-selling console for the last four years and to reach one billion hours of play across gaming and entertainment demonstrates that PlayStation is the leading entertainment platform and continues to be Australia’s favourite place to play.”

In the past 12-months the PS4 has seen multiple exclusive titles released including Horizon: Zero Dawn, GT: Sport and Uncharted: The Lost Legacy.
